Bernice Alcorn (nee Van Duyne)

"Niecy"

Age 85 of Wilmington, passed away Sunday May 11, 2014 at Presence Villa Franciscan in Joliet.

Born June 18, 1928 in Manhattan, Bernice Eula was a daughter of the late Peter and Gertrude Glass-Van Duyne. She was raised in Wilmington and on June 28, 1947, Bernice married Donald Alcorn in the rectory at Saint Rose Catholic Church in Wilmington. She was a member of St. Rose and worked at the Joliet Arsenal prior to going into residential cleaning in the Wilmington area. She enjoyed reading, gardening, playing cards and dancing. Niecy and Don took pleasure in traveling and she cherished her grandchildren and great grandchildren.
